发明名称 Wireless foot controller
摘要 The invention includes systems and methods for controlling devices including surgical instruments using a wireless footswitch. The systems of the invention include a wireless footswitch, a footswitch adapter, and an electric console for powering and controlling surgical instruments. The systems of the invention further include a wireless footswitch for controlling battery powered surgical instruments. The methods of the invention include syncing a wireless footswitch with a controlled device or a wireless footswitch adapter using a lower power wireless mode, then signaling the controlled device or wireless footswitch adapter using a higher power wireless mode. The systems and methods of the invention include using a wireless device or wireless footswitch adapter to monitor transmissions from other wireless devices to prevent syncing with the wireless footswitch adapter using the same channel or network identification as other wireless devices or wireless footswitch adapters.

主权项 1. A system for wirelessly controlling a surgical instrument comprising: a wireless footswitch comprising a first wireless transceiver and a pedal configured to be operated by a foot of a user and to provide a pedal signal in response, wherein the pedal signal is converted to a control signal transmitted by the first wireless transceiver; a surgical instrument or a wireless footswitch adapter with a second wireless transceiver;wherein the first wireless transceiver is configured to transmit sync signals in a lower power mode and, upon syncing between the first and second wireless transceivers, the first wireless transceiver transmits control signals in a higher power mode and wherein syncing between the first and second transceivers is possible when the first transceiver is not in close proximity to second transceiver.
